Wire Splice Connectors

Wire splice connector terminals are devices that provide an insulated or non-insulated point of electrical connection for two or more conductors secured by crimping, soldering, friction, screw, IDC or a wire nut (twist on). They are selected by the number and gauge of the wire. The terminal types are butt splice, closed end, single opening, crimp band, open band, inline, or tap.
